5 Days From Agadir to Marrakech via Sahara Desert

Overview :

The 5 Days From Agadir to Marrakech via Sahara Desert is a journey from Morocco’s Atlantic coast to the red city of Marrakech through southern towns, valleys, gorges, kasbahs, the Sahara desert, and the High Atlas Mountains. This tour is designed for travelers who start in Agadir and want to experience the Merzouga desert before ending the trip in Marrakech.

Your journey starts in Agadir and travels through Taroudant, Taliouine, Ouarzazate, and the valleys of southern Morocco. Along the way, you will discover Anti-Atlas landscapes, old kasbahs, palm groves, and traditional villages before reaching Dades Valley and Todra Gorges.

The route continues towards Merzouga, near the dunes of Erg Chebbi. In the Sahara desert, you will ride camels across the golden dunes, enjoy the sunset, have dinner at the desert camp, and spend the night under the stars.

After the desert experience, the journey continues through Rissani, Alnif, Draa Valley, Ouarzazate, Ait Ben Haddou, and the High Atlas Mountains before ending in Marrakech.

This 5 Days From Agadir to Marrakech via Sahara Desert tour is ideal for travelers who want a complete desert route from Agadir with enough time to enjoy southern Morocco, camel trekking, Sahara camp, kasbahs, valleys, and mountain landscapes.

Itinerary

Day 1: Agadir - Taroudant - Taliouine - Ouarzazate

Your 5 Days Desert Tour From Agadir to Marrakech via Sahara Desert starts in the morning with pick-up from your accommodation in Agadir. We leave the Atlantic coast and drive towards Taroudant, a historic town known for its old walls, traditional souks, and southern Moroccan atmosphere.

After a short stop in Taroudant, we continue towards Taliouine, a region known for saffron and Anti-Atlas landscapes. The road passes through small villages, mountain scenery, and open southern landscapes before reaching Ouarzazate.

Ouarzazate is often called the gateway to the desert and is known for its kasbahs, film studios, and location between the Atlas Mountains and the Sahara routes.

Dinner and overnight stay will be at a hotel or riad in Ouarzazate.

Day 2: Ouarzazate - Skoura - Rose Valley - Dades Valley - Todra Gorges

After breakfast, we leave Ouarzazate and continue through Skoura palm groves, an area known for old kasbahs and traditional villages. The journey continues through the Rose Valley, famous for its valley landscapes and local rose products.

We continue towards Dades Valley, known for its rock formations, kasbahs, and scenic road views. Several stops can be made along the way for photos and short breaks.

After visiting Dades Valley, the journey continues towards Todra Gorges. These high rocky cliffs are one of the most impressive natural sites in southern Morocco, with time to walk and enjoy the views.

Dinner and overnight stay will be at a hotel or riad near Todra Gorges or Tinghir.

Day 3: Todra Gorges - Erfoud - Rissani - Merzouga Desert

After breakfast, we continue the journey through the desert road towards Erfoud and Rissani. The road passes through palm areas, desert villages, and open landscapes before reaching the Sahara region.

Erfoud is known for fossils and desert products, while Rissani is a historic town linked to old caravan routes and traditional markets. Depending on the day, we can stop near the market area before continuing to Merzouga.

By the afternoon, we arrive in Merzouga, near the dunes of Erg Chebbi. You will ride camels across the golden dunes and enjoy the sunset over the Sahara.

After the camel trek, you will reach the desert camp. Dinner will be served at the camp, followed by a peaceful night under the stars. Overnight stay will be in a desert tent.

Day 4: Merzouga Desert - Rissani - Alnif - Draa Valley - Agdz

Wake up early to enjoy the sunrise over the dunes before breakfast at the camp. After breakfast, we leave Merzouga and begin the journey through southern Morocco.

The route passes again through Rissani before continuing towards Alnif and the desert landscapes that lead to the Draa Valley. This long valley is known for its palm groves, old kasbahs, traditional villages, and desert scenery.

We continue through the valley road towards Agdz, a peaceful town surrounded by palm groves and mountain views.

Dinner and overnight stay will be at a hotel or riad in Agdz or nearby area.

Day 5: Agdz - Ouarzazate - Ait Ben Haddou - High Atlas Mountains - Marrakech

After breakfast, we leave Agdz and drive towards Ouarzazate. From there, the journey continues to Ait Ben Haddou Kasbah, one of Morocco’s most famous fortified villages and a strong example of traditional earthen architecture.

After visiting Ait Ben Haddou, we cross the High Atlas Mountains through the Tizi n’Tichka pass. Several stops can be made along the way for panoramic views, coffee, or short breaks.

The road passes through Berber villages and mountain landscapes before reaching Marrakech.

By the late afternoon or evening, we arrive in Marrakech. The 5 Days From Agadir to Marrakech via Sahara Desert tour ends with drop-off at your accommodation.
